About These Strains

Gold Leaf

Hybrid 50/50 — THC 17–23% — CBD 3–3%

Gold Leaf is a rare slightly indica dominant hybrid strain (60% indica/40% sativa) created through an unknown combination of other hybrid strains. Even though its true parentage is kept a closely guarded secret by its breeders, Gold Leaf is highly sought after for its positive and uplifting high and long-lasting effects.

The Gold Leaf high has a quick-hitting effect, lifting the spirits almost as soon as you experience your first exhale.

Gorilla Cookies

Hybrid 50/50 — THC 21–24% — CBD 0–1%

Gorilla Cookies is a hybrid cannabis strain through crossing the classic Thin Mint Girl Scout Cookies X Gorilla Glue #4 strains. Looking for a high-powered level of potency and long-lasting effects?

You've found it with Gorilla Cookies.
